Leveraging Emergent Change, Chaos and Conflict to Gain a Competitive Advantage:

As organizations strive to be more and more competitive, and compete for talent on a world-wide global stage, ensuring that the best and brightest people and ideas are captured has become crucial. This breakfast seminar will explore things such as 

  • Conflict - Sharing Gears, Shifting the view of conflict, from being confrontational, negative and something to be ‘fixed’ or ‘eliminated’ to being one of necessity as an organization builds and/or sustains competitive advantage.
  • Emergent change – learning to leverage change that emerges as front-line employees do their jobs and make decisions that might otherwise be different than those who did those jobs before, versus waiting for top-level management to see clear to a vision of change and then impose that change upon the organization
  • Order vs. Chaos – When there is too much order, what happens? When there is too much chaos, what happens? How can we – and why would we need both to compete

Speaker:

Linda Gregorio is a highly sought after leadership coach, workshop leader and speaker. Successful in various executive management roles, such as CEO, Vice President Corporate Strategy and Vice President, Worldwide Sales and Service, and having worked globally (Canada, the US, Europe and Austral-Asia) Linda draws on her proven executive management experience, as well as her US-based executive coach training in her current business – Presents of Mind, a firm specializing in Organizational and Leadership Development.
